Young Dr. East, Los Angeles, CA 90095, USA COMMENT Mycobacterium phage Marsha was isolated from an enriched soil sample from Holland, MI, USA by Danielle Goodman (Hope College). Illumina sequencing was performed by Hope College with an approximate shotgun coverage of 104x. Genome was annotated by Divya R. Adem, Clara E. Bang, Maral Daneshpazhouh, Katarina Q. Ho, Charmaine A.
